6143 825 image1938, 20¢ Presidential (Scott 825), on cover from New York to Greece, Returned: on oversized envelope, 20 Garfields (three pairs plus 16 singles), plus three 50¢ Tafts (#831) on corner ad cover addressed to Athens; stamps tied by multiple strikes of New York, NY, GPO duplexes dated Feb. 17, 1941; endorsed in red "Via Transatlantic Clipper Air Mail" at lower left; boxed "Not Opened/by/Censor" handstamp lower right contradicted by Egyptian censor's bilingual tape at left and violet handstamp at center; boxed "No Service" and multiple boxed "Retour" handstamps on face; reverse, interestingly, sports a Victoria, Hong Kong, 1 MR 41 handstamp plus a "Returned Letter Office/30 AU/41/Hong Kong" dater as well; stamps replaced, paper wrinkles and edge flaws as to be expected from this round-the-world cover, Fine to Very Fine, a great item for the wartime postal historian. 6156   image[U.S.S. Los Angeles] Hull fabric, three pieces described in the accompanying photocopy of a letter to collector Fred Hambrock, Jr. on N.A.S. Lakehurst letterhead dated Dec 30, 1929, and signed by H.M. Dietzman, Production Engineer: 1.) "a small piece of one of the two parachutes carried on the U.S.S. Shenandoah on her disastrous flight"; 2.) a "piece of printed fabric…the kind and quality of cotton cloth used for the outer cover of the U.S.S. Los Angeles" which "was made in England for the Zeppelin Company in Germany, the builders of the Los Angeles"; and 3.) a piece of aluminized fabric "representative of the kind of fabric now used on the Los Angeles and is fast replacing the fabric used by the Germans.".
